Mesothelioma Compensation From a Legal Claim

You can get compensation for your mesothelioma. On average, trial verdicts give victims between $5 million and $11.4 million.

Mesothelioma victims may also be eligible for compensation from trust funds and settlements. Additionally, veterans who were exposed to asbestos during military service may be eligible for benefits from the VA.

1. Medical expenses

Mesothelioma can be a fatal illness and patients are often left with huge medical bills. A legal claim for compensation can aid patients in paying for treatment and provide financial security to their families in the future.

Asbestos lawyers can decide if a victim is eligible to file a mesothelioma lawsuit through a no-cost case review. Victims should act as quickly as possible to protect their right to compensation.

A mesothelioma suit or asbestos trust fund claim can aid in the payment of a victim's medical expenses and other costs. A mesothelioma lawyer can take care of all the details of a claim and ensure they get the maximum amount of compensation.

Asbestos-related victims may also be eligible for financial assistance through programs like Medicare, Medicaid, long-term disabilities insurance or Social Security disability payments. These programs may pay for a portion of a patient's mesothelioma treatment, and typically have lower copays than private health insurance.

Veterans who were part of the United States military are at an increased risk of mesothelioma. Asbestos was extensively used in military aircrafts, ships, and buildings during World War II, and tens of millions of veterans were exposed to asbestos. Patients diagnosed with mesothelioma could be eligible for VA benefits and may also file a lawsuit against asbestos-containing product manufacturers.

4. Damages for emotional distress

Many people who have been affected by asbestos-related diseases have experienced emotional trauma. In certain cases, this can include fear, anger, sadness, grief and depression. These damages are able to be claimed in a mesothelioma suit and may result in compensation.

Certain patients could also be qualified for disability or pension benefits through the Department of Veterans Affairs or the SSA. These programs are not part of the legal process, but still provide victims with financial aid to pay for living expenses. For instance, those diagnosed with peritoneal or pleural mesothelioma might be eligible for the compassionate allowance. These benefits offer a more rapid application and fewer requirements than traditional disability applications.
